3. Enhance Safety and Compliance

Flying drones requires more than just buying one and going out with it.

Safety is a priority, so there are strict limits on drone flight across several countries. Understanding these laws and following them correctly ensures the lawful and safe operation use of drones. If you sign up for an ELCAS drone course, you can learn about the local laws and guidelines surrounding drone operation and how to fly your equipment legally and safely.

Abiding by the rules, but realizing the potential hazards and challenges that come with drone use and ensuring security, too. Subjects like risk assessment and safe flying strategies are what you can encounter during ELCAS drone coaching.

5. Improve Technical Proficiency

Drones have advanced sensors cameras, and they have become more & more complex than ever before. Just imagine that these gadgets are your musical instrument, but only you have the power to create the music by using your fingers, with no one guiding or helping you how or what to do except yourself — if you know how they work technically.

An ELCAS drone course will teach you the ins and outs of drone technology, including how to fly, maintain your drone, diagnose problems, and set up software.

Moreover, it often includes real-time training on multiple drone types, allowing hands-on practice of flying and utilizing different types of drones. This real-life practical training will be invaluable for you as it turns you into a practical, confident drone pilot.
